The Theatre Chipping Norton and Selladoor Worldwide present Reduced Shakespeare Company in The Complete Works of William Shakespeare (abridged) by Adam Long, Daniel Singer and Jess Winfield. Brand new fully revised version!
The worldwide comic phenomenon returns with a totally revised and updated romp through all 37 of the Bard’s plays (with some sonnets thrown in too). Grab your tickets now for a wild and irreverent ride that leaves audiences breathless with laughter!
After nine years in London’s West End, two TV specials, and performances in over 20 countries, Reduced Shakespeare Company are reinventing this classic masterpiece for the next generation of audiences. Expect fact-paced comedy, chaotic costume changes, and plenty of sword fights.
As The Today Show once said, “If you like Shakespeare, you’ll like this show. If you hate Shakespeare, you’ll love this show!”

Theatre Royal Bury St Edmunds was designed and built in 1819 by William Wilkins. With many of its original features still intact, it is a superb example of a Regency playhouse and one of the most beautiful, intimate and historic theatres in the world.
